NEPHELOstar - Technical Specifications

Detection Mode

Nephelometry

Measurement Modes

Endpoint and Kinetic measurements

Microplate Formats

Up to 384-well plates

Light Source

Self-monitoring laser diode
Wavelength 635±10 nm
Stability <0.2% deviation
Lifetime 20,000 hours
Output: 1 mW
Selectable beam width: 1.5 to 3.5 mm
Selectable Intensity 0-100%
Scattering angle: Detects up to 80° full cone angle

Sensitivity

Depends on particle size and liquid properties
Silica detection (particle size 0.5 to 10 µm) 800 nM

Dynamic Range: 5 decades
Maximum measurement value (1s= 500,000 Relative Nephelometry Units)

Reading Speed

Depend on assay conditions and liquid surface stability
23 s (96), 66 s (384)

Reagent Injection

Up to 3 built-in reagent injectors
Injection at measurement position (6 to 384-well)
Individual injection volumes for each well (3 to 350 µL)
Variable injection speed up to 420 µL / s
Up to four injection events per well
Reagent back flushing

Shaking

Linear, orbital, and double-orbital with user-definable time and speed

Gas Vent

System to inject an atmosphere or to pull a vacuum into the reader

Incubation

+5°C above ambient up to 38°C

Software

Software package including Reader Control and MARS Data Analysis software

Dimensions

Width: 44 cm, depth: 48 cm, height: 33 cm
Weight: 25 kg
